Dutchman Oebele de Haan has done it again

A freight elevator

He repairs lorries and builds cranes and Oebele de Haan is your man if you need to install emergency stairs. The Frisian’s newest idea is a freight elevator between the storage hall upstairs and the technical rooms downstairs. All sorts of boxes can now be moved elegantly directly from the intensive care station’s door to e.g. the entrance of the operating wing. The fascinating apparatus even has a special braking-device!
